The is a secondary school in Limbe, . Known by its acronym NCHS Limbe, the school was created in 1972 by some parents who were interested in commercial education, at the time when most of the schools around that part of Cameroon were public schools offering mainly general education. is situated 1 km south of Namé recycling.
